FUENGIROLA

It is the third Major tourist development on this section of Spain's Costa del Sol. This huge resort covers some 10km of coastline with intensive developments of hotels and apartments many of them high rise forming the typical concrete jungle resort which attracts tourists.
The Beaches are impressive and spread the whole length of the resort area apart from the central marina area from where you can take part in a selection of water sports. Surprisingly in such a tourist centre you'll still see fishermen out on their small trawlers each morning catching your evening meal should you frequent one of Fuengirola's seafood restaurants where the morning's catch becomes the evening specialty.

Tuesday is a big day for Shopaholics when the weekly market which moves up and down the coast each day is set up in the centre of town and is the the Costa del Sol's most popular market destination. If you're feeling a little more energetic you'll find plenty places from where you can go windsurfing and scuba diving is popular.
There's a zoo which should keep the kids amused for a few hours as well as a water park. The main square, Plaza de la Constitución, has been re-designed but still retains its unique enchantment. It looks pretty especially at Christmas and Fuengirola Summer Festival where the whole town takes part in the annual street celebrations.

Golf
Fuengirola is especially popular with golfers as it is ideally located for access to a wide selection of courses on what has become known as Spain's Costa del Golf.
